Maintaining and Replacing Shock Absorbers on Your 2019 Haval H6

Shock absorbers are indeed a key component of the 2019 Haval H6, playing an essential role in ensuring a smooth and controlled driving experience. If you're cruising down the motorway or tackling winding roads, well-functioning shock absorbers are crucial to keeping your ride comfortable and safe. They work tirelessly to absorb bumps and vibrations, enhancing both handling and vehicle stability. Therefore, maintaining and replacing them as needed should be on your vehicle maintenance checklist.

When it comes to keeping your shock absorbers in top shape, regular inspections are a good starting point. Whether you're an expert behind the wheel or not particularly car-savvy, being aware of how your vehicle feels on the road can help you identify potential issues. If you notice your Haval H6 bouncing excessively, swaying during turns, or even braking less efficiently, it could be time for a check-up. Here we'll guide you through understanding when and how to replace or maintain these essential parts.

  1. Signs of Worn Shock Absorbers
    • Bumpy Rides: Feeling every bump and crack on the road is a sign your shocks might need attention.
    • Nose Diving: If the front end of your car dips sharply during braking, it's a classic symptom of worn shocks.
    • Uneven Tyre Wear: This can indicate that your shocks are not keeping your tyres firmly planted on the road.
    • Oil Leaks: Visible oil stain on the shock absorbers is a sign that it's time for replacements.
  2. Basic Maintenance Tips
    • Inspect Regularly: Have a look at your shock absorbers every 20,000 kilometres or so. Checking for visible damage or leaks can pre-empt problems.
    • Listen to Your Car: Trust your driving instincts. If your vehicle starts to handle differently, particularly on bumpy roads, it could be shock absorber trouble.
    • Professional Check-Up: Have a qualified mechanic inspect the shock absorbers at least once a year. They can provide an expert opinion on when replacement is necessary.
  3. Steps for Replacement
    • Purchase Quality Parts: Stick with OEM or reputable aftermarket brands that suit your Haval H6. Quality matters because cheaper parts might compromise safety.
    • Sourcing a Professional: Unless you're a seasoned DIY mechanic, it's wise to have a professional take care of the replacement. They have the tools and expertise to ensure it's done right.
    • Alignment Check: Once your shock absorbers are replaced, ensure your wheel alignment is checked and adjusted if necessary. This can prevent uneven tyre wear and improve handling.
  4. Why Timely Replacement Matters
    • Enhanced Safety: Effective shock absorbers help your car maintain proper traction, reducing the risk of accidents.
    • Optimal Performance: The Haval H6 is equipped with features to provide a comfortable and smooth ride. Keeping your shock absorbers in good condition is key to enjoying these benefits.
    • Cost-Effective: Replacing worn shock absorbers can save you money in the long run by preventing damage to other suspension components and reducing tyre wear.
